I no longer grow my own grapes but I select grapes from some of the best vineyards and growers in the valley.

The Clare Valley is one of the most picturesque wine regions in the world. Its wonderful warm dry summers with low humidity and cool nights make it as disease free as vineyards can be. Those cool nights keep our average ripening temperature down and allows us to sleep at night as well.

Solid winter rains and moisture grabbing clays over good draining limestone or slate are ideal soils for minimal watering and premium grape growing.
